AMBIENCE The ambience is literally lit, like you see bulbs everywhere. Ceiling is barely visible as it's covered with plethora of yellow light bulbs arranged in an array. The entrance waiting area is beautiful, has mirror work on the wall, bouquets of flowers and the line lights. The seating is regular at the entry hall, but in the second hall next to bar counter, it has round table seating along with regular seating joined with the wall. The walls showcase a variety of work, wooden, exposed brick finish and couch like. Seating is comfortable and couch or cushion base based. The music played is good and overall appeal is Cozy.
FOOD °5 mushroom galouti kebab° I love mushroom and galouti kebab, but this preparation turned out average. The melting in mouth softness and juicyness was missing. The taste was average and towards more salty side, probably the 5 mushroom mix didn't render a delicious blend. I have had mushroom galouti before at other brands and hence know they could make it way better. Was served on samosa crust.
°Trio of paneer Kulcha° So this was minced and spiced paneer in kulcha pockets, served on an achari bed. Without the Achar touch, the dish turned out essentially bland. The spice mix didn't help much and veggie mix was also little.
°Dal makhni° The savior for the night, the dal Makhni was authentic, cooked well and with apt consistency. The spice level was to my exact liking.
°Paneer masala lahori° It was more or less like kadhai paneer only, just bit more on gravy, semi dry to be precise. The taste and quantity was good.
°Tandoori roti° Never seen such massive rotis, with 130 bucks per roti, the size and crispiness was well justified. It was mentioned to them to make it Crisp, good that PBN serves roti as per requirement.
°Gulab jamun cheesecake° The ending was a highlight, probably the only modern Indian dish I could try. Tiny gulab jamuns in good number placed in the cheesecake matrix, both right in texture and apt in sweetness. Presentation could have been better for such a fancy dessert.
